WANTED TO LEASE LEASING BY TENDER NEW CITY HOTEL Courtenay Place, Wellington THE PUBLIC TRUSTEE Invites tenders for the leasing of the New City Hotel situated on the comer of Kent terrace and Marjoribanks street, Wellington. This Hotel, rebuilt in 1939, is a three-storeyed concrete building comprising 2 main bars, lounge bar, dining, r °o™. sitting room, 28 bedrooms, 42 pillows, Manager s flat, pottle store, ample bathrooms, shower and beer tanks, good yard and cellar space. Full facflitiM available for staff. Grading 3 star plus, but could be raised. Conditions of Tender may he inspected at, and any further particulars obtained by personal application at the Offices of The District Public Trustee at Wellington, Auckland. Christchurch. Dunedin, Palmerston North, Napier and Wanganui. A deposit equal to one quarter’s rent at the rate tendered must accompany each tender. The highest or any tender will not necessarily be accepted. Tenders close at noon on February 28, 1961, at the Office oC the District Public Trustee, Wellington, to whom tenders are to be addressed in a sealed envelope marked “Tender For Lease of New City Hotel.’’ G.
